Transaction 50de4bcf21c3883de660147ad098735aab20066f439509f291ef2476d229f532
2 Input
2 Outputs
- 50de4bcf21c3883de660147ad098735aab20066f439509f291ef2476d229f532:0
- 50de4bcf21c3883de660147ad098735aab20066f439509f291ef2476d229f532:1
value 2209131
address 1N284TQMj11uA2HpEnSJfpaNYqkpBJFoDh
value 3700000
address 34LMfq2SPwyzBEHMe92u8KQAsXe5Am5izV